Figure Drawing
Monthly on Wednesdays: July 9, August 13, September 10, October 8, November 12, and December 17 | 6 - 8 pm | $15 per session
The Foundry Art Centre is offering an opportunity to draw from a live model without instruction. The Foundry will provide a model for 2 hours during which participants can practice their figure drawing at their own pace, work on incorporating a figure into an existing piece, or however they’d like to use their time. Foundry staff members – who are also practicing artists – will facilitate the session. Each session will include a series of short poses (1 – 5 min) as well as some longer poses (10 – 20min). This class is for adult students (ages 21+). Space is limited and registration is required. It is recommend that participants bring tools and surfaces of their choice to the session. Punch Needle with Dee Levang
Saturday, November 8 | 1 to 4 pm | $75
Join artist Dee Levang to learn everything you need to know to create a punch needle project. In this comprehensive 3-hour workshop, you will learn all the skills required to make a punch needle artwork from start to finish. Through the process of punching a "mug rug" coaster, you'll pick up a whole bunch of tips and tricks along the way. This class is suitable for total beginners, as well as those who have tried punch needle before but are looking for more in-depth guidance on technique. You'll come away from this class with a small art piece or coaster in a design of your choice -- and the knowledge to create future pieces of any size! Dee Levang is an American multidisciplinary visual artist working in fiber, encaustic, oil and cold wax, and water-soluble media. Born and raised in the Los Angeles area, she currently resides and works in St. Louis, Missouri. She studied graphic design at California Institute of the Arts (CalArts). As a teaching artist, she teaches classes and workshops both locally and regionally, including at Contemporary Art Museum Saint Louis, St. Louis Artists' Guild, St. Louis Community College, and the Foundry Art Centre in St. Charles.
An alumnus of the Saint Louis Art Fair’s Emerging Artists as Entrepreneurs program, Levang has participated in local juried art fairs and events including Schlafly's Art Outside, Cherokee Street Print Bazaar, Maplewood's Let Them Eat Art, Queeny Park Art Fair, and Wall Ball.

Gold Stacker Ring Workshop with Shanika Hartrum
Saturday, December 13 | 11 am – 1:30 pm | $95
Ready to dip your toes into the shiny world of goldsmithing? This beginner-friendly workshop is the perfect place to start! Artist Shanika Hartrum from Moon.u.mental Jewelry will lead you in the creation of your very own custom set of gold-filled stacker rings. No experience necessary! Students can choose to make a personalized set of 2-3 stunning gold-filled rings to mix, match, or stack high and proud! Shanika will guide students through the essential techniques of working with gold-filled metal such as: measuring & shaping, filing & polishing, using a torch to solder, and pro finishing techniques. This class is open to students ages 16+. All supplies provided, just bring yourself, a friend or two, and your creativity!
